integrated graphics is a waste of time....

 

Unless you don't play computer games or only play like football manager or the sims...in which case its really useful for the average joe

 

iris pro is really powerful, especially in current gen crystalwell processors like in the 15" macbook pro

 

according to notebookcheck http://www.notebookcheck.net/Intel-Iris-Pro-Graphics-5200.90965.0.html

"Thanks to the fast eDRAM memory, the average performance of the Iris Pro is only about 15 percent behind the dedicated mid-range cards GeForce GT 650M and GT 750M (DDR3 versions). This makes the Iris Pro even faster than AMDs Radeon HD 8650G and the fastest integrated GPU of 2013"

 

an improvement can only be good for general consumers
